a question about the coil


hi guys am going to change the coil over on andreas roadster to a gt 40 that i have but my problem is the coil on the car is not marked with +ve or -ve. Can someone please confirm that power from ignition goes to +ve and -ve goes to distributor. Cheers david

A coil will work either way round....
although Not as well, when its around the wrong way...
and it can cause problems...

Positive + Power to the coil +
Negative - to the points & condenser.

make shure its a gt40 not a gt40R as the R model is designed to work with a ballast resistor and will quickly destroy your points if you use it
